Right so you throw a chunk of silver in your cistern and put an ozonizer or UV in the delivery line close to the point of use.  I learned how to make colloidal silver back around 1997 and it is amazing stuff. I had a friend with a freshwater fish tank that was having problems with fish dying from some bacteria or fungus.  I told him about silver and he threw a chunk of silver cut from a 1 oz bar into the tank and that was the end of the problem.  At home in my water treatment system (yes I don't trust the municipality to get it right) I have a combination of elements including a membrane, and UV sterilizer.  I noticed during maintenance that some of the filters in the system downstream of the activated carbon (which removes the chlorine) and upstream of the UV would get a clear slimy coating gowing over the filter media over time.  I threw a chunk of silver into the housings and the slime never returned. A large cistern with a couple of pure silver bars in it with just a hundred microamps  flowing between them should keep the water fresh. Making colloidal silver uses more like 20 miliamps for a short period of time and you need to make sure the silver is at least 99.9 % pure or better if possible.  You need to start with distilled water to avoid creating silver compounds electrochemically. Use current regulation rather than voltage regulation and the process is optimized by the addition of ultrasonic energy to keep the nanoscale particles from adhering to the electrodes.An old ultrasonic humidifier works well for this.  Put water in the transducer well and sit a mason jar into the well with your distilled water in it.  The ultrasonics couple right through the glass of the jar into your forming colloid quite nicely. Afterwards although the water won't look any different to the naked eye, the beam from a laser pointer will be clearly visible in the water which will not be the case in distilled or DI water.  Adding just a few drops of the colloid to a vase with cut flowers will keep the water from going putrid until long after the flowers are gone.  I had carnations in a mason jar of tap water (chlorine removed) with a teaspoon of colloid added, for over a month!  Get a nasal sprayer and dump out the addictive antihisamine crap, rinse it out and put silver colloid in.  Whenever a sore throat comes on at the first sign, spray the back of the throat and nasal passages and conserve your energy while your immune system gears up.  This is better than drinking colloid which I don't recommend and only uses a few drops per application which you do as needed.
